Value Proposition

While other novelty apps poll the CPU constantly to read raw XYZ data, EcoDrop hooks into native, hardware-gated low-power motion thresholds, keeping the main CPU asleep until an actual high-velocity drop occurs.

Product Direction

An ultra-optimized Android app utilizing Android's hardware-backed low-power Significant Motion Sensor APIs and batching algorithms to deliver real-time drop sound triggers with zero noticeable idle battery drain.

RISKS & ASSUMPTIONS

Top Risks

Android OEM background optimization kills app

Aggressive battery saving frameworks by OEMs like Samsung or Xiaomi might shut down the low-power sensor hook entirely.

SEV 4
Sensor inaccuracy across lower-end devices

Budget phones may lack specialized low-power hardware motion co-processors, forcing fallback to CPU-draining monitoring.

SEV 3
Short novelty lifecycle

Users might tire of the comedic audio aspect quickly, causing churn before monetizing custom sounds.
